Description

Wedding Band is an American comedy-drama television series created by Darin Moiselle and Josh Lobis which follows four friends who, despite their ups and downs, spend their spare time performing in a wedding band, having come to the decision that weddings are the wildest parties in town.

The series aired in the USA on TBS from 10 November, 2012 to 19 January, 2013. There are 10 hour-long episodes in one season.

The series originally aired in South Africa on DStv's M-Net Series channel from 31 January to 4 April, 2013, on Thursdays at 19h30. New episodes broadcast weekly. It later aired on M-Net Series Zone. See "Seasons" below for seasonal broadcast dates and times.

Wedding Band premiered on M-Net Series Zone on Wednesday 25 September 2013, at 18h30. New episodes broadcast from Mondays to Thursdays at the same time.

Synopsis

Delivering equal parts comedy and heart, Wedding Band centres on the bromance between four likable but occasionally reckless young men who can't figure out their own lives.

One thing they have figured out, however, is that weddings are the wildest parties in town. After all, the groupies are bridesmaids, the drinks are free and the best part - there's a paycheck waiting at the end of the night.

And it's not just weddings. Mother of the Bride also brings the party to bar mitzvahs, high-school reunions and even bachelorette parties.

On lead vocals and playing the crowd is perennial bachelor Tommy (Brian Austin Green). Shredding it on guitar is his best friend and married father of two, Eddie (Peter Cambor).

Behind Eddie on drums –and everything else in life – is his rock-obsessed brother, Barry (Derek Miller), whose mission is to bring the arena-rock spectacle to black-tie events.

New to the band is Stevie (Harold Perrineau), a bassist and session musician who's jammed with all the big rock giants, "from AC to ZZ," but he's never been an official member of a band until Mother of the Bride.

Together these four guys provide the soundtracks to other people's lives. But now the band is ready to take things to the next level.

That means attracting the attention of top event manager Roxie Rutherford (Melora Hardin) and her novice associate Rachel (Jenny Wade) and keeping Eddie out of trouble with his wife, Ingrid (Kathryn Fiore).
